Definition and meaning of English word "series"

series

/ˈsɪəriːz/

Meaning

Noun

A number of things that follow on one after the other or are connected one after the other.

How to use

The term 'series' is often used in the context of television shows, referring to a sequence of episodes that follow a particular storyline or theme. In academic and professional settings, 'series' can also refer to a sequence of events, products, or publications. A common grammatical nuance is the use of 'series' as a singular noun, despite its plural form.
